LabCorp is seeking a full time Project Manager at Esoterix in Calabasas, CA.  

Hybrid Work Schedule: Monday - Friday 9:00am -5:00 PM (2 days in office, 3 days remote)

Job Responsibilities:

  • Lead multiple, high-priority projects and programs that support business growth and innovation
  • Collaborate across departments to align project outcomes with strategic goals
  • Build and manage detailed work plans, drive milestones, and deliver updates to key stakeholders
  • Analyze options, manage risk and change, and help shape data-driven decisions that elevate performance
  • Lead project management teams to deliver on projects that span across different areas of the business
  • Determine and define scope and objectives. Break complex projects into simpler tasks and set goals and timeframes
  • Plan, budget, and manage resources to execute projects effectively, including forecasting needs, tracking costs, and ensuring alignment with timelines and deliverables.
  • Lead cross-functional teams and vendors, resolving conflicts, guiding prioritization, and mentoring peers to ensure smooth collaboration and successful project outcomes.
  • Communicate project status and progress through regular updates, documentation, presentations, and reports to stakeholders and senior leadership.
  • Analyze workflows, performance metrics, and business needs to identify gaps, assess strategies, and continuously improve processes and decision-making.

Minimum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in a Chemical or Biological science, Clinical Laboratory Science or Medical Technology
  • 1 year or more experience in project management

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Current or previous laboratory experience
  • PMP Certification

Additional Job Standards:

  • Demonstrated ability to facilitate all areas of the PM lifecycle: Scope/Planning/Execution/Closure and mentor others through process
  • Proven ability to manage large integrated projects across multiple disciplines
  • Skills with project management software tools, methodologies and best practices
  • Proven ability to complete projects according to outlined scope, budget and timeline
  • Strong problem-solving, analytical, and detail-oriented skills with a creative approach to challenges
  • Excellent communication, interpersonal, and collaboration abilities
  • Highly organized and resourceful with strong time-management capabilities
